Ticket: Vault lockout blocking audit-log viewer deploy

The Bramblevale audit-log viewer can't start because its signing vault sealed itself after three failed unlock attempts during last night's rotation. On-call should unseal the vault manually, restart the viewer pods, and confirm log ingestion resumes. Standard unlock tokens were invalidated by the failed attempts, so manual recovery is required. Use the recovery passphrase noted immediately below to unseal.

recovery phrase for fawif-tajeg: norael-aldmir-casir-brivan-ulaion

# Env file for the fd-leak investigation on the Cresthollow render fleet
# On-call: the descriptor-leak tracer (hatchwatch) must run with this file
# sourced, or it silently skips the socket audit and you will chase ghosts.
# Odile confirmed the leak correlates with the thumbnail worker's retry loop,
# so keep tracing enabled until the Marrow 3.1 patch lands. The tracer
# authenticates against the Cresthollow telemetry gateway, and its access
# secret must appear on the line directly below.

sealed setting: VAULT_KEY20=c8ea1e419912889df6b4

// REINDEX_BATCH_CAP limits docs per shard pass in the Tallowfield
// nightly search reindex. Raising it starves the ingest queue;
// lowering it overruns the maintenance window. 5000 is the tested
// sweet spot. Change only with a soak run. Verified against the
// build noted below.

session token of bawif-hahog = htk6_ac5981

[ ] Thumbnail queue (Snapcrate workers): confirm image parsing runs in the sandboxed decoder, not the legacy in-process path — the legacy path is the one flagged in last quarter's review. Verify queue messages are signed and workers reject unsigned payloads. Malformed-image fuzz suite must be green before sign-off. Record your approval against the candidate build identified by the token below.

trace token, kahog-tajeg: htk6_97d963